# Netflix Stock Analysis: Trading at $84.66 with Mixed Analyst Views | Market Update Discover the latest on Netflix (NFLX) stock in this comprehensive market analysis episode. We break down Netflix's current trading position at $84.66, well below its 52-week high but showing strong fundamentals despite market pressure. Learn about Netflix's impressive Q4 results with 17.6% revenue growth, bullish 2026 guidance projecting 12-14% revenue expansion, and what analysts are saying with price targets ranging from $95 to $129. We examine the impact of potential regulatory hurdles for the proposed $82.7B Warner Bros. acquisition, significant insider selling, and technical indicators showing an oversold position.
